SUMMARY

A practical guide designed to help novices avoid and solve problems at sea, on rivers and in the harbor, this book covers the handling of cruisers, the preparation required before going to sea and the various aspects of safety and survival - such as learning about weather and how the sea behaves, matching the speed to the conditions and knowing how to navigate effectively - which may be relevant when things go wrong. The environment in which a motor cruiser operates is explained, as are the effects of waves on a boat's behavior and the way to get the best out of a boat and enjoy it. Dag Pike, a lifeboat inspector for RNLI and the navigator on Virgin Atlantic Challenger I and II, is a regular contributor to 'Motorboats Monthly' magazine.Pike, Dag is the author of 'Practical Motor Cruising' with ISBN 9780229118274 and ISBN 0229118275.
